TXN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review

1,348 of the 4,363 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Texas Instruments (TXN)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$87.1B — down 0.55% from $87.6B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 138 funds opened new TXN positions and 91 closed out — a net gain of 47 holders — while 459 added to existing stakes and 545 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$2.29B. The largest seller was Capital Research Global Investors, cutting an estimated $830M.
